Safety Instructions

If a cooker hood is installed above the gas hob, ensure that the burners are always
covered with a pan when in use. Otherwise flames could reach the cooker hood, parts of
which could then be damaged or set on fire.
Do not store flamable material under a cooker hood. The flames could set the
cooker hood on fire.
Do not use the appliance as a resting place for anything else. The article could melt or
catch fire if residual heat is still present or if the appliance is switched on by mistake.
Do not cover the appliance, e.g. with a cloth, kitchen foil, etc. This could be a fire hazard
if residual heat is still present or the appliance is switched on by mistake.
Do not uses plastic or aluminium foil containers. These melt at high temperatures and
could catch fire
Do not heat up unopened tins of food on the hob as pressure will build up in the tin,
causing it to explode. This could result in injury and scalding or damage.
Make sure all the components of the gas burners have been correctly assembled before
switching on.
Pans must be the correct size for the burner they are used on (see "Suitable pans"). A
pan which is too small will be unstable on the pan support. If the pan diameter is too
large, flames can spread out to the sides and damage or burn the worktop, wall
claddings or surrounding units and also parts of the hob.

Can I use my pans on induction?

Nowadays almost all pans are suitable for induction. You can easily test whether your old pans can also be used on induction by holding a magnet against the bottom of the pan. If the magnet stays on the pan, your old pan is suitable for induction.

How do I reset my induction hob?

Most induction hobs can be reset by disconnecting the hob from power by unplugging it from the power outlet. You will then have to wait at least 60 minutes.

What is a Perilex connection?

A Perilex connection is a special connection that can handle more power than a normal connection. This connection has five holes instead of two and is often used for induction hobs.
